Close Menu
    Facebook X (Twitter) Instagram
    Articles Stock
    • Home
    • Technology
    • AI
    • Pages
      • About us
      • Contact us
      • Disclaimer For Articles Stock
      • Privacy Policy
      • Terms and Conditions
    Facebook X (Twitter) Instagram
    Articles Stock
    AI

    Stanford Researchers Launch OpenJarvis: A Native-First Framework for Constructing On-System Private AI Brokers with Instruments, Reminiscence, and Studying

    Naveed AhmadBy Naveed Ahmad13/03/2026Updated:13/03/2026No Comments6 Mins Read
    videos images


    Stanford researchers have launched OpenJarvis, an open-source framework for constructing private AI brokers that run completely on-device. The undertaking comes from Stanford’s Scaling Intelligence Lab and is introduced as each a analysis platform and deployment-ready infrastructure for local-first AI methods. Its focus isn’t solely mannequin execution, but additionally the broader software program stack required to make on-device brokers usable, measurable, and adaptable over time.

    Why OpenJarvis?

    In line with the Stanford analysis staff, most present private AI initiatives nonetheless hold the native element comparatively skinny whereas routing core reasoning by means of exterior cloud APIs. That design introduces latency, recurring price, and knowledge publicity considerations, particularly for assistants/brokers that function over private information, messages, and chronic consumer context. OpenJarvis is designed to shift that steadiness by making native execution the default and cloud utilization non-compulsory.

    The analysis staff ties this launch to its earlier Intelligence Per Watt analysis. In that work, they report that native language fashions and native accelerators can precisely serve 88.7% of single-turn chat and reasoning queries at interactive latencies, whereas intelligence effectivity improved 5.3× from 2023 to 2025. OpenJarvis is positioned because the software program layer that follows from that consequence: if fashions and client {hardware} have gotten sensible for extra native workloads, then builders want an ordinary stack for constructing and evaluating these methods.

    https://scalingintelligence.stanford.edu/blogs/openjarvis/

    The 5-Primitives Structure

    On the architectural stage, OpenJarvis is organized round 5 primitives: Intelligence, Engine, Brokers, Instruments & Reminiscence, and Studying. The analysis staff describes these as composable abstractions that may be benchmarked, substituted, and optimized independently or used collectively as an built-in system. This issues as a result of native AI initiatives usually combine inference, orchestration, instruments, retrieval, and adaptation logic right into a single hard-to-reproduce software. OpenJarvis as an alternative tries to offer every layer a extra specific function.

    Intelligence: The Mannequin Layer

    The Intelligence primitive is the mannequin layer. It sits above a altering set of native mannequin households and offers a unified mannequin catalog so builders should not have to manually observe parameter counts, {hardware} match, or reminiscence tradeoffs for each launch. The objective is to make mannequin alternative simpler to check individually from different components of the system, such because the inference backend or agent logic.

    Engine: The Inference Runtime

    The Engine primitive is the inference runtime. It’s a widespread interface over backends similar to Ollama, vLLM, SGLang, llama.cpp, and cloud APIs. The engine layer is framed extra broadly as hardware-aware execution, the place instructions similar to jarvis init detect obtainable {hardware} and advocate an acceptable engine and mannequin configuration, whereas jarvis physician helps keep that setup. For builders, this is likely one of the extra sensible components of the design: the framework doesn’t assume a single runtime, however treats inference as a pluggable layer.

    Brokers: The Conduct Layer

    The Brokers primitive is the habits layer. Stanford describes it because the half that turns mannequin functionality into structured motion below actual gadget constraints similar to bounded context home windows, restricted working reminiscence, and effectivity limits. Slightly than counting on one general-purpose agent, OpenJarvis helps composable roles. The Stanford article particularly mentions roles such because the Orchestrator, which breaks advanced duties into subtasks, and the Operative, which is meant as a light-weight executor for recurring private workflows. The docs additionally describe the agent harness as dealing with the system immediate, instruments, context, retry logic, and exit logic.

    Instruments & Reminiscence: Grounding the Agent

    The Instruments & Reminiscence primitive is the grounding layer. This primitive contains assist for MCP (Mannequin Context Protocol) for standardized software use, Google A2A for agent-to-agent communication, and semantic indexing for native retrieval over notes, paperwork, and papers. It additionally assist for messaging platforms, webchat, and webhooks. It additionally covers a narrower instruments view that features internet search, calculator entry, file I/O, code interpretation, retrieval, and exterior MCP servers. OpenJarvis is not only a neighborhood chat interface; it’s meant to attach native fashions to instruments and chronic private context whereas maintaining storage and management native by default.

    Studying: Closed-Loop Enchancment

    The fifth primitive, Studying, is what provides the framework a closed-loop enchancment path. Stanford researchers describe it as a layer that makes use of native interplay traces to synthesize coaching knowledge, refine agent habits, and enhance mannequin choice over time. OpenJarvis helps optimization throughout 4 layers of the stack: mannequin weights, LM prompts, agentic logic, and the inference engine. Examples listed by the analysis staff embrace SFT, GRPO, DPO, immediate optimization with DSPy, agent optimization with GEPA, and engine-level tuning similar to quantization choice and batch scheduling.

    Effectivity as a First-Class Metric

    A significant technical level in OpenJarvis is its emphasis on efficiency-aware analysis. The framework treats power, FLOPs, latency, and greenback price as first-class constraints alongside activity high quality. It additionally emphasizes on a hardware-agnostic telemetry system for profiling power on NVIDIA GPUs by way of NVML, AMD GPUs, and Apple Silicon by way of powermetrics, with 50 ms sampling intervals. The jarvis bench command is supposed to standardize benchmarking for latency, throughput, and power per question. That is vital as a result of native deployment isn’t solely about whether or not a mannequin can reply a query, however whether or not it may accomplish that inside actual limits on energy, reminiscence, and response time.

    Developer Interfaces and Deployment Choices

    From a developer perspective, OpenJarvis exposes a number of entry factors. The official docs present a browser app, a desktop app, a Python SDK, and a CLI. The browser-based interface may be launched with ./scripts/quickstart.sh, which installs dependencies, begins Ollama and a neighborhood mannequin, launches the backend and frontend, and opens the native UI. The desktop app is out there for macOS, Home windows, and Linux, with the backend nonetheless operating on the consumer’s machine. The Python SDK exposes a Jarvis() object and strategies similar to ask() and ask_full(), whereas the CLI contains instructions like jarvis ask, jarvis serve, jarvis reminiscence index, and jarvis reminiscence search.

    The docs additionally state that all core performance works with no community connection, whereas cloud APIs are non-compulsory. For dev groups constructing native functions, one other sensible characteristic is jarvis serve, which begins a FastAPI server with SSE streaming and is described as a drop-in alternative for OpenAI shoppers. That lowers the migration price for builders who need to prototype in opposition to an API-shaped interface whereas nonetheless maintaining inference native.


    Take a look at Repo, Docs and Technical details. Additionally, be happy to comply with us on Twitter and don’t overlook to affix our 120k+ ML SubReddit and Subscribe to our Newsletter. Wait! are you on telegram? now you can join us on telegram as well.




    Source link

    Naveed Ahmad

    Related Posts

    Gross sales automation startup Rox AI hits $1.2B valuation, sources say

    13/03/2026

    ‘Uncanny Valley’: Anthropic’s DOD Lawsuit, Conflict Memes, and AI Coming for VC Jobs

    13/03/2026

    Substack launches a built-in recording studio

    13/03/2026
    Leave A Reply Cancel Reply

    Categories
    • AI
    Recent Comments
      Facebook X (Twitter) Instagram Pinterest
      © 2026 ThemeSphere. Designed by ThemeSphere.

      Type above and press Enter to search. Press Esc to cancel.